Soft Vintage Glow

This recipe builds on Fujifilm’s Classic Chrome film simulation, known for its muted tones and a nostalgic atmosphere reminiscent of Kodachrome. This recipe softens highlights and shadows to reduce harsh contrasts and preserve detail, while boosting colour and shifting white balance to create a warm tone by increasing the reds and adding richness to blues. A subtle addition of grain provides a tactile, film-like texture.

Overall, this recipe emphasizes a richly toned, vintage-cinematic look with smooth details and pronounced colour depth. The strong colour chrome effects accentuate colour nuances, while reduced clarity and modest grain promote an organic, film-like softness. This recipe is especially beneficial when you want a warm, nostalgic, film-like mood with gentle contrast.

  • Classic Chrome

  • Dynamic Range: DR400

  • Highlight: -2

  • Shadow: -2

  • Colour: +3

  • High ISO NR -4

  • Sharpness: 0

  • Clarity: -3

  • Grain Effect: Weak, Small

  • Colour Chrome Effect: Strong

  • Colour Chrome Effect Blue: Strong

  • White Balance: Daylight, +4 Red, -5 Blue

  • ISO: Auto (minimum of 500)
